- Pennsylvania receives an average solar irradiance of about 4 kWh/m²/day
- The state has over 1,500 MW of installed solar photovoltaic capacity as of 2024
- Local solar panel installations typically achieve efficiencies between 15% and 22%
- In Pennsylvania, typical home solar systems generate approximately 10,000 kWh each year
- Net metering policies allow credits for excess solar energy fed back to the grid
